Our policy is to list price our guitars with 75% margins, which is standard for these types of instruments, and typically sell the guitars at 60% margin (markup). This puts our guitars selling at $870 - $1,084. We manage the small storefront with min/max inventory levels of each guitar based on historical sales over the past year. These inventory levels are further managed with a ceiling of $10,000 (approximately one month historical income from selling an average of 22 guitars per month) based on total costs per guitar in the store.
